Vous êtes sur la page 1sur 4

SNMP

Simple Network Management


Protocol

   

Interpeak SNMP Agent


Control and supervision of modern networks can quickly become a challenging task, especially
when handling heterogenous network topologies. The Interpeak SNMP Agent resolves this by
providing a uniform management interface using the industry-standard SNMP protocol.

Control and man-


agement of
modern networks is a challenging task
the networked devices. An SNMP agent
is a software module which resides in
the managed device, and communicates
The second incarnation of SNMP
appeared in 1993, and was an ambi-
tious attempt to address a number of
due to the complexity and diversity of with the manager using the SNMP pro- deficiencies in SNMPv1 as well as add-
the connected devices. A standardiza- tocol. ing new features. Implementations of
tion of the management strategy is Interpeak recognizes SNMP as the this new standard did however reveal a
therefore a necessity to enable success- standard for network management, and number of problems that lead to a ma-
ful supervision of such networks. has designed an SNMP agent tailored jor revision of the specifications, with a
The Simple Network Management specifically for use in dedicated devices. less comprehensive set of features
Protocol (SNMP) is the most widely It is the ideal solution for embedded added. The new SNMPv2 specification
used network management solution for systems that require a fully functional was released in 1996, and introduced
TCP/IP networks. It is an open stand- SNMP agent with high performance e.g. a locking mechanism, 64-bit
ard-based framework that is simple but and yet small footprint. The Interpeak counters and improved error reporting.
yet flexible enough to manage many SNMP agent is standards compliant, The most recent addition to the
different types of devices in today’s dis- and supports both SNMP version 1 and protocol is named SNMPv3. It is basi-
tributed network environment. 2, as well as the recently defined ver- cally SNMPv2 with a number of secu-
sion 3. rity additions like a Security Model and
SNMP Model an Access Control Model. The specifi-
The SNMP model assumes the exist- SNMP History cation documents also describe an over-
ence of managers and agents. An SNMP SNMP was defined in the late eighties, all architecture for describing SNMP
manager is a software module in a man- with the first implementations appear- management frameworks and a model
agement system, respon- ing in the end of 1988. The original for message processing and dispatching.
iso (1) sible for handling of version of the protocol—SNMPv1—
org (3) configuration contained the five reqest/response SNMPv3 Security Features
dod(6) and statis- primitives: get-request, set-request, get- SNMPv3 is designed to secure against
internet (1) tics of next-request, get-response, and trap. the following security threats:
directory (1) • Modification of Information, i.e. al-
mgmt(2) tering of the message in transit.
mib-2 (1) • Masquerading, i.e. an entity may
system (1) sysDescr (1) hide its entity and pretend to be
interfaces (2) sysObjectID (2) someone else.
at (3) sysUpTime (3)
1.3.6.1.2.1.1.3 • Message Stream Modification, i.e.
ip (4) sysContact (4) reordering or replay of the messages.
icmp (5) sysName (5)
• Disclosure, i.e observation of sensi-
tcp (6) sysLocation (6)
tive information such as passwords.
udp (7) sysServices (7)

egp (8)
SNMPv3 does however not secure
transmission (10)
against Denial of Service attacks or Traf-
snmp (11)
fic analysis.
experimental (3)

private(4)

enterprises (1)

Structure of Management Information (SMI).


SNMP Agent Features

The SNMP model of network


management that is used
for TCP/IP networks includes the fol-
lowing components:
• Management station • Implements the original SNMP version 1
• Management agent • Implements SNMPv2c which is the standardized variant
• Management information base of SNMPv2.The “c” means community based SNMPv2.
• Network management protocol • Supports SNMPv3 which includes security enhancements.
• Support both for IPv4 and IPv6. The SNMP agent may be
Management Station configured in IPv4 only, IPv6 only or dual IPv4/IPv6 mode.
The management station serves as the • All three Get methods are supported; GetRequest,
interface for the human network man- GetNextRequest and GetBulkRequest
ager into the network management sys-
• Implements the SetRequest method.
tem. The station translates the network
management tasks into actual com- • Provides generic traps such as coldStart, linkUp/linkDown
mands sent on the network. The man- etc., as well as API functions for sending custom enterprise
agement station is typically a stand- specific traps.
alone device. • Includes community based authentication based on com-
munity name, source address/mask and access level.
Management Agent
The management agent is the software
module that resides on the managed Interpeak SNMP features.
device. It responds to requests for in-
formation and actions requested by
network management stations. The agent may also spontaneously transmit runs over UDP which means that
information about events in the device. retransmissions have to be handled by
Agents typically reside on network de- the SNMP management stations and
SNMPv1 vices such as host, switches, routers, agents.
RFC 1155 firewalls, gateways etc.
RFC 1157 Integrated with Interpeak´s
RFC 1212-1213 Management Information Base Protocol Stacks
RFC 1215 The managed information is repre- Interpeak SNMP comes by default with
sented with objects, one for each aspect support for the MIB-2 snmp and sys-
SNMPv2 of the managed device. The object is in tem groups. If using Interpeak’s IPNET
RFC 2011-13 essence a data variable of a predefined TCP/IP stack, the remaining MIB-2
RFC 2096 type. The collection of objects on a spe- groups are also predefined including the
RFC 2452 cific device is referred to as a Manage- new IPv6 MIBs. Interpeak SNMP also
RFC 2454 ment Information Base or MIB. Each provides a programming interface for
RFC 2465-66 type of device has its own MIB, for ex- private MIBs to support customer prod-
RFC 2576 ample the “Printer MIB” (RFC 1759) ucts.
RFC 2578-80 or the “UPS MIB” (RFC 1628). The SNMP agent also supports the
RFC 3416-18 TestAndIncrement textual convention
Network Management which can be used to prevent concur-
SNMPv3 Protocol rent use of the same MIB object by two
RFC 3410-15 The protocol used for management of different managers. This may be essen-
TCP/IP networks is SNMP. Usually it tial in Set operations.

RFCs supported by Interpeak SNMP.


Interpeak Secure Networking Software
Interpeak provides state-of-the-art networking solutions specifically designed for
embedded systems. The company´s embedded networking and security software
is currently used in thousands of applications across the globe.
Headquartered in Stockholm, Sweden, Interpeak operates through a global
network of distribution channels and has its own sales and field application force
dispersed in strategic locations worldwide, including the USA, Europe, and Asia.
For additional information, please visit our homepage www.interpeak.com.

All Interpeak products are trademarks or registered trademarks of Interpeak AB. Other brand and product
names are trademarks or registered trademarks of their respective holders. The information in this docu-
ment has been carefully reviewed, and is believed to be accurate and reliable. However, Interpeak AB
assumes no liabilities for inaccuracies in this document. Furthermore, Interpeak AB reserves the right to
change specifications embodied in this document without prior notice.
Version 1.22-r5. Copyright © 2005, Interpeak AB. All rights reserved.

Vous aimerez peut-être aussi